We recently developed an air-liquid interface long-term culture of differentiated bovine oviductal epithelial cells (ALI-BOEC). This ex vivo oviduct epithelium is capable of supporting embryo development in co-culture up to the blastocyst stage without addition of embryo culture medium. Mouse embryo culture has been established and applied in the study of the causal mechanisms of abnormal development. Mouse embryo culture can be used as an experimental system to examine the influence of teratogen on early development, together with investigations using developmental engineering such as chimera, transgenic mice and nuclear transfer. Embryo quality is crucial to the outcome of in vitro fertilization (IVF); however, the ability to precisely distinguish the embryos with higher reproductive potential from others is poor. Morphologic evaluation used to play an important role in assessing embryo quality, but it is somewhat subjective.
